
What is Emotional Intelligence (EQ)?
This is the ability to understand, use and manage your own emotions in positive ways so as to relieve stress, communicate effectively, empathize with others, overcome challenges and manage conflicts.
Emotional Intelligence helps you:
• Build stronger relationships, succeed at school and work so as to achieve your career and personal goals.
• It can also help you connect with your feelings, turn thoughts into action and assist in making decisions on what matters most to you.
EQ is commonly defined by five attributes:
Personal competences
( These competences determine how we manage ourselves)
i. Self-awareness – Knowing one’s internal state, preferences, resource and intentions
ii. Self-regulation – managing one’s internal states impulses, resources
iii. Motivation – Emotional tendencies that guide or facilitate reaching goals
Social Competences
(These competences determine how we handle relationships)
iv. Empathy – Awareness of others feelings, needs and concerns
v. Social Skills – Adeptness in inducing desirable responses in others.
